Handover — Gateway rate limiting (Ferrow → Adil)

For the release manager: the Quillgate internal API gateway now enforces per-client token buckets instead of the old global counter. The burst allowance was tuned after the Hollis batch jobs kept tripping 429s during nightly runs. Nothing else in routing changed. Shadow mode ran clean for two weeks, so the limits are enforced in prod as of this release. The active limiter configuration for the gateway is reproduced below.

deployment values, yadug-bawif:
[framir]
team = pelox
access_code = ac_a38ab2
owner = tamion.julael
host = framir.tolvaqlabs.test
port = 11211
peer = tammir.zemvargrid.local
salt = 2215ef03
pin = 1541

Subject: PickPath key rotation this Friday

Hi plugin folks,

Heads up — we're rotating the credentials for the PickPath optimizer API at the end of the week. Anything your plugins send to the pick-list scoring endpoint will start bouncing with 401s once the old key dies, so please swap it out before Friday evening, Dunmore time. Nothing else changes: same endpoints, same rate limits, same quirks you've learned to love. For sandbox testing in the meantime, use the temporary key below.

gateway credential: kto3_qfe

Minutes — Management Meeting, Harkwell Supplies

Present: Dalia, Ruben, Tomasz. We agreed the revised commission scheme: flat 4% base, 6% above quota, paid monthly instead of quarterly. Finance to model cash impact by Friday. Dalia flagged clawback rules need tightening before rollout. Ruben will draft comms for the reps. One item stays close-hold for now.

board note of kageg-bahof: The renewal with Holwynax Holdings closes at $2 million a year, 5 percent below the last contract. Project Ulaath slips by two quarters because of the supplier delay.